Troubleshooting Using Gauge Readings
The following examples help you determine the possible cause of a problem by observing the
gauge readings on the inlet (vacuum) and outlet (pressure) side of the pumping unit. Actual
readings may vary slightly, depending on installation and environmental conditions.
Figure 5-4: Gauge Troubleshooting 1
Symptoms: No Flow; Nozzle Open
Check Inlet Side
Probable Causes:
• Control Valve Stuck Shut
• Bypass Valve Open
• Atmospheric Float Valve Open
• Stuck Rotor Blades
• Broken Suction Line
• Strainer or Filter Completely
Plugged or in Backwards
• Empty Tank
